NewsAnalyst predicts The Elder Scrolls Online will use subscription model before free-to-play
Gamesbrief consultant Nicholas Lovell predicts that The Elder Scrolls Online will follow a monthly payment plan before adopting a free-to-play model later on.
"I still believe that subscription games are on the way out," Lovell told Edge. "It is conceivable that Bethesda will launch with a subscription service to attract the early adopters, because that is the model they understand."
Subscription numbers for both Blizzard's World of Warcraft and EA's Star Wars: The Old Republic have shown a decline by two million and 24% of gamers, respectively.
The Elder Scrolls Online is slated to release in 2013 for PC and Mac. ZeniMax Online Studios has been developing the MMO since 2007.
